“Brachytherapy”, also called “Internal radiation therapy”, represents an advanced approach within the realm of radiation therapy, a cornerstone of cancer treatment. Unlike conventional external beam radiation therapy, which emanates radiation from a machine outside the body, brachytherapy involves placing radioactive particles or sources directly inside or adjacent to the tumor site.

By doing so, brachytherapy delivers a targeted, high dose of radiation precisely to the tumor, while minimizing exposure to surrounding healthy tissues. This focused delivery allows for the administration of high radiation doses to specific areas of the body, enhancing treatment efficacy.

This therapy finds application in the treatment of various cancers, including cervical, prostate, breast, skin, lung, head and neck, and gum cancer, among others. Particularly, it is a widely utilized procedure for prostate cancer treatment, offering an alternative to surgery for gum cancer patients who may be unfit or do not require surgical intervention. One of the notable advantages of brachytherapy lies in its efficiency, as treatment completion often requires fewer sessions compared to conventional radiotherapy techniques. Moreover, many patients undergo brachytherapy on an outpatient basis, further enhancing its accessibility and convenience. Overall, brachytherapy is well-tolerated by patients, with fewer side effects reported, making it a valuable therapeutic option in the fight against cancer.

Types of Brachytherapy

There are two types of brachytherapy treatment:

Temporary brachytherapy: In this method, highly radioactive particles are placed in a catheter or slender tube for a specific amount of time and then withdrawn. Temporary brachytherapy can be administered at either a low-dose rate (LDR) or a high-dose rate (HDR).

Permanent brachytherapy: In this method, a radioactive seed or pellet is implanted in or near the tumor and left there permanently. After several months, the radioactivity level of the implanted seed eventually diminishes to nothing.

Preparation may involve blood testing, imaging tests (CT, MRI, or ultrasound), and at times an assessment of anesthetic. Depending on the location of the cancer, you might need to stop taking some medications, fast before the surgery, and follow specific hygiene or bladder-emptying instructions.

Brachytherapy involves positioning Radioactive material inside or close to the tumour. Small radioactive seeds, wires, or pellets may be inserted using applicators, catheters, or needles; the technique may be temporary or permanent, depending on the nature and location of the tumours. The treatment may be guided by imaging (like ultrasound or CT) and is usually done in an outpatient setting or with a short hospital stay.

HDR brachytherapy is often performed as an outpatient procedure and lasts 10 to 30 minutes. After 1-2 hours of LDR brachytherapy, radioactive seeds are permanently left in the body.

High radiation doses are sent directly to the tumor with this treatment, protecting healthy tissue in the process. For localized malignancies, it has a high efficacy rate, fewer side effects, and a shorter treatment duration.

Post-operative recovery from brachytherapy is typically faster than that from external radiation, depending on the type and site of treatment. Although insignificant side effects like tiredness, bowel or urine abnormalities, and local discomfort may occur, most patients are able to return to their regular activities in a matter of days. Rest, proper hydration, and follow-up care promote a speedy recovery and help detect any delayed side effects.

The success rate of brachytherapy for localised tumours, such as breast, cervical, and prostate cancer, is high and frequently ranges from 85% to over 95%.

Process Involved for Brachytherapy in Istanbul

  • Consultation: Discuss the diagnosis, treatment options, and appropriateness of brachytherapy with an oncologist or radiation oncologist.
  • Pre-Treatment Assessment: Imaging tests are used to determine the tumour's exact size and location.
  • Treatment Planning: Precise positioning of radioactive sources within or near the tumor is planned with precise imaging. The treatment is personalised for every patient to decrease exposure to radiation of surrounding healthy tissue.
  • Delivery of Treatment: To provide large doses of radiation to the tumor and spare nearby tissues, small radioactive sources are placed inside or near the cancer for a limited period.
  • Follow-Up: Regular follow-up visits are scheduled after treatment to monitor the response of the tumor, manage side effects, and search for recurrence.
